Description
Note:Mimeographed reproductions of typescript, pictorial borders, and drawings on folded leaves of mostly coarse brown paper; 2 full-page illustrations on white bond; green tissue-paper endpapers. Stapled at left margin and glued to brown paper liners of green tie-dyed linen covers. Covers are illustrated with decorated-paper and wood-veneer cutouts and tied at fore-edge with suede ties. Other preliminaries illustrated with mounted paper cutouts.
With a construction of cardboard, crepe, and other decorated papers, and lace, tulle, twigs, etc., that functions as a case for the book and represents the author's house with accompanying tree, moon, and stars. Includes a paper cutout representing a wooden shingle with two holes for hanging, labeled Emily Dickinson.
Part of a collection of handmade books, most with cords for hanging (literatura de cordel), published by Ediciones Vigía under the auspices of the Cuban Ministry of Culture.
Publication information from colophon.
Translations were made from Thomas H. Johnson's edition of The Complete Poems of Emily Dickinson. Boston: Little, Brown, 1960.
"Consta de doscientos ejemplares numerados ... Los primeros cien ejemplares de este libro van en un estuche que recrea la casa donde viviera la autora y contiene además un árbol, la luna y un cielo con ángeles y estrellas que la resguardan y lo convierten en una muestra de arte instalacionista que deviene homenaje a la gran poetisa norteamericana"--Colophon.
